Cosa imparerai
Being More Optimistic is a short, practical audio course designed to help you cultivate a positive and resilient mindset. Over three lessons, you’ll learn to recognize and challenge negative thinking, reframe setbacks into growth opportunities, and develop a daily gratitude practice. Each lesson offers simple, actionable exercises that can be applied immediately, helping you build optimism as a skill that lasts a lifetime. Lezione 1
Identifying And Challenging Negative Thinking
In this lesson, you’ll learn to notice your automatic negative thoughts and understand how they influence your outlook. You’ll explore common thinking patterns, such as all-or-nothing thinking and catastrophizing, and practice reframing them into more balanced, realistic perspectives. By the end, you’ll have a simple method to gently shift your thoughts toward optimism.
Lezione 2
Reframing Setbacks As Opportunities
This lesson focuses on turning challenges and setbacks into opportunities for growth and learning. You’ll practice cognitive reappraisal by asking key questions that help you see hidden possibilities in difficult situations. By reframing obstacles, you can reduce stress and approach problems with a more resilient, optimistic mindset.
Lezione 3
Practicing Daily Gratitude And Building Lasting Optimism
In the final lesson, you’ll develop a daily gratitude practice to reinforce a positive mindset. You’ll learn to notice and savor small positives in your day, strengthening your ability to focus on what’s going well. The lesson concludes with a reflection on the skills you’ve learned, helping you build lasting optimism and resilience.
